Course Content

• Introduction to Nanotechnology and Sustainable Packaging
• Nanomaterials for Packaging Applications: Synthesis and Characterization
• Nanotechnology for Barrier Enhancement in Food Packaging (with focus on bio-based nanomaterials)
• Nanostructured Coatings for Active and Intelligent Packaging
• Life Cycle Assessment and Environmental Impact of Nano-enabled Packaging
• Regulations and Safety Aspects of Nanomaterials in Packaging
• Sustainable Packaging Design Principles and Nanotechnology Integration
• Case Studies: Successful Applications of Nanotechnology in Sustainable Packaging

Certificate Programme in Nanotechnology for Sustainable Packaging Materials is increasingly significant in the UK's burgeoning green economy. The UK's packaging waste generation reached 12 million tonnes in 2020 (Source: DEFRA), highlighting the urgent need for sustainable alternatives. This programme addresses this crucial market demand by equipping professionals with the knowledge to develop innovative, eco-friendly packaging solutions using nanotechnology. The course covers topics such as biodegradable polymers, nanocoatings for improved barrier properties, and lifecycle assessment of nano-enabled packaging. This specialized training directly responds to industry needs for experts capable of designing and implementing sustainable packaging strategies, contributing to a circular economy and reducing environmental impact.
